Recalls for 2014 Hyundai Santa Fe

3 NHTSA recall campaigns affecting ~2,086,906 vehicles.

23V651000Service Brakes, Hydraulic:antilock/traction Control/electronic Limited Slip:control Unit/module
~1,649,478 affected

Hyundai Motor America (Hyundai) is recalling certain 2011-2015 Elantra, Genesis Coupe, Sonata Hybrid, 2012-2015 Accent, Azera, Veloster, 2013-2015 Elantra Coupe, Santa Fe, 2014-2015 Equus, 2010-2012 Veracruz, 2010-2013 Tucson, 2015 Tucson Fuel Cell, and 2013 Santa Fe Sport vehicles. The Anti-Lock Brake System (ABS) module may leak brake fluid internally and cause an electrical short, which can result in an engine compartment fire while parked or driving.

17V358000Latches/locks/linkages:hood:latch
~437,400 affected

Hyundai Motor America (Hyundai) is recalling certain 2013-2017 Santa Fe and Santa Fe Sport vehicles. In the affected vehicles, the secondary hood latch actuating cable may corrode and bind, causing the secondary hood latch to remain in the unlatched position when the hood is closed.

13V624000Tires:sidewall
~28 affected

Hyundai is recalling certain model year 2014 Santa Fe vehicles manufactured November 5, 2013, through November 15, 2013, and equipped with P235/65R17 103T Continental Crosscontact LX tires. The tires may have a damaged sidewall.

2014 Hyundai Santa Fe — FAQ

Answers based on real NHTSA complaint and recall data for this specific model year.

Is the 2014 Hyundai Santa Fe reliable?
Verdict: Above Average Complaints. The 2014 Hyundai Santa Fe has 676 NHTSA complaints, 27 crash-related, and 3 recall campaigns. The most common issue is Engine Problems with 271 complaints. Source: NHTSA via VinItel.
What are common problems with the 2014 Hyundai Santa Fe?
Top reported problems: Engine Problems (271 complaints, avg 91,122 mi); Steering Defects (52 complaints, avg 38,511 mi); Electrical Faults (48 complaints, avg 54,890 mi). Every complaint is filed by an owner with NHTSA — this is raw reported data, not editorial opinion.
At what mileage do problems start on the 2014 Hyundai Santa Fe?
The weighted average mileage at time of complaint is about 71,332 miles. Some components fail earlier, some later — check the "All Problems by Category" table above for per-issue averages.
How safe is the 2014 Hyundai Santa Fe?
NHTSA complaints for the 2014 Hyundai Santa Fe include 27 crash-related reports, 43 fire reports, 37 injuries, and 0 fatalities. These are owner-reported incidents, not official crash-test ratings — a complaint being filed doesn't confirm a defect, but clusters around specific components are worth investigating.
